  1. how many protons, neutrons, and electrons should be included in the atom model of a nitrogen atom?

a) 7 protons, 2 neutrons, and 7 electrons
b) 7 protons, 7 neutrons, and 7 electrons
c) 14 protons, 2 neutrons, and 7 electrons
d) 14 protons, 7 neutrons, and 7 electrons

Explanation:

Step1: Determine the number of protons

The atomic number of nitrogen is \(7\). The atomic number is equal to the number of protons. So, the number of protons in a nitrogen atom is \(7\).

Step2: Determine the number of electrons

In a neutral atom, the number of electrons is equal to the number of protons. Since the number of protons is \(7\), the number of electrons is also \(7\).

Step3: Determine the number of neutrons

The mass number of nitrogen is \(14\). The mass number is the sum of protons and neutrons. Using the formula \(mass\ number=protons + neutrons\), we can find the number of neutrons. Substituting the values, \(14 = 7+neutrons\), so \(neutrons=14 - 7=7\).

Answer:

B. 7 protons, 7 neutrons, and 7 electrons
